01 -
Cook the macaroni and cheese according to the package instructions. Return the mac and cheese to the saucepan and simmer for 1 minute until thickened. Stir in cheddar cheese until melted for better consistency.
02 -
Pour the mac and cheese mixture onto a parchment-lined baking sheet. Cover with another sheet of parchment and spread to approximately 3/4 inch thickness. Refrigerate for at least 1 hour.
03 -
Remove the chilled mac and cheese from the refrigerator. Using a cookie cutter, cut out rounds of pasta.
04 -
Take the mac and cheese rounds and wrap a thin layer of ground beef evenly around each disc.
05 -
Cook the stuffed burgers on a grill or stovetop, ensuring not to overcook to prevent the mac and cheese from spilling out. Remove from heat once the pasta begins to leak slightly.
06 -
Place cooked burgers on buns and add preferred toppings such as tomatoes and toasted breadcrumbs. Serve immediately.
